@charset   "Shift_JIS";

body{
	font-size : 14px;
text-align : center;
margin-top : 0px;
margin-left : 0px;
margin-right : 0px;
margin-bottom : 0px;
padding-top : 0px;
padding-left : 0px;
padding-right : 0px;
padding-bottom : 0px;
background-image : url(images/y6b.gif);
background-repeat : repeat;
line-height : 120%;
}

#container{
	width : 900px;
text-align : left;
border-left-width : 1px;
border-right-width : 1px;
border-left-style : solid;
border-right-style : solid;
border-left-color : gray;
border-right-color : gray;
margin : 0px auto auto;margin-bottom : auto;margin-bottom : 0px;
background-color : white;
}

#header{
	height : 130px;
background-image : url(images/terra4_2.gif);
background-repeat : no-repeat;background-position : 100% 100%;
background-color : #fbfffb;
border-bottom-width : 1px;
border-bottom-style : dotted;
border-bottom-color : gray;
width : 900px;

margin-top : 0px;
padding-top : 0px;

}

#main{
	width : 700px;
float : left;
padding-top : 10px;
padding-left : 10px;
padding-bottom : 10px;
}

#menu{
	width : 170px;
float : right;
padding-top : 10px;
padding-bottom : 10px;
padding-right : 5px;
text-align : center;
padding-left : 5px;
background-repeat : repeat;
background-color : #fbfffb;
}

#footer{
	background-color : #cccccc;
width : 900px;
text-align : center;
clear : both;
}

a{
	text-decoration : none;
color : #3e3eff;
}

a:link{
	color : #3e3eff;
}

a:visited{
	color : #0000ff;
}

a:hover{
	color : maroon;
}

h1{
	font-size : 14px;
margin-bottom : 1px;
padding-left : 10px;
margin-top : 0px;
background-image : url(images/top.gif);
}

h2{
	margin-bottom : 0px;
font-size : 20px;
}

.timg{
	margin-left : 10px;
margin-right : 10px;
}

.left{
	width : 320px;
height : 180px;
float : left;
padding-top : 10px;
padding-left : 60px;
}

.right{
	width : 320px;
height : 180px;
float : right;
padding-top : 10px;
}

.liya{
	line-height : 150%;
list-style-image : url(images/v2_lis020.gif);
margin-top : 0px;

}

.b1{
	color : white;
background-color : teal;
text-align : center;
width : 690px;
clear : both;
}

.jyu{
	width : 220px;
height : 200px;
float : left;
}

.ai{
	width : 220px;
height : 200px;
float : right;
}

.syoku{
	width : 230px;
float : right;
height : 200px;
}

.cover{
	width : 460px;
float : left;
}

.b1img{
	margin-top : 10px;
margin-left : 10px;
margin-right : 10px;
margin-bottom : 10px;
}

.b1img2{
	margin-right : 5px;
margin-left : 0px;
}

.ac1{
	font-size : 15px;
color : white;
background-color : #ff80c0;
width : 340px;
clear : both;
float : left;
text-align : center;
}

.bc1{
	color : white;
background-color : #8080ff;
text-align : center;
width : 340px;
float : right;


}

.cover2{
	width : 690px;
clear : both;
}

.ac2{
	width : 335px;
float : left;
padding-left : 5px;
padding-right : 5px;
padding-top : 5px;
font-size : 13px;
line-height : 130%;
}

.bc2{
	padding-left : 5px;
padding-right : 5px;
padding-bottom : 0px;
width : 335px;
float : right;
padding-top : 5px;
font-size : 13px;
line-height : 130%;
}

.text2{
	font-size : 12px;
line-height : 130%;
padding-top : 3px;
}

.ac3{
	color : white;
background-color : #ff9460;
width : 330px;
text-align : center;
margin-top : 3px;
margin-bottom : 3px;
font-size : 13px;
line-height : 130%;
}

hr{
	border-width : 1px 1px 1px 1px;border-top-style : dotted;border-right-style : dotted;border-bottom-style : dotted;border-left-style : dotted;border-color : #cccccc #cccccc #cccccc #cccccc;

}

.ad1{
	color : white;
background-color : #009999;
width : 340px;
float : left;
text-align : center;
}

.bd1{
	color : white;
background-color : silver;
text-align : center;
width : 340px;
float : right;
}

.ae1{
	color : white;
background-color : #8080ff;
text-align : center;
width : 340px;
float : left;
}

.be2{
	color : white;
background-color : #ffa6ff;
text-align : center;
width : 340px;
float : right;
}

.linone{
	margin-top : 5px;
margin-left : 5px;
margin-right : 5px;
margin-bottom : 5px;
list-style-type : none;
bottom : auto;
font-size : 13px;
line-height : 180%;
}

.waku{
	font-weight : bold;
color : olive;
background-color : #ffefe8;
text-align : center;
width : 330px;
padding-top : 5px;
padding-bottom : 5px;
margin-top : 2px;
margin-bottom : 2px;
}

.cover3{
	background-image : url(images/d017bcg.gif);
background-repeat : repeat;
margin-top : 5px;
margin-left : 5px;
margin-right : 5px;
width : 690px;
border-width : 1px 1px 1px 1px;border-style : dotted dotted dotted dotted;border-color : green green green green;
clear : both;
}

.text2gr{
	font-size : 13px;
font-weight : bold;
color : #004000;
}

.text2go{
	font-size : 13px;
font-weight : bold;
color : olive;
}

#menu h3{
	font-size : 13px;
background-color : #ffffca;
border-bottom-width : 1px;
border-left-width : 1px;
border-bottom-style : dotted;
border-left-style : dotted;
border-bottom-color : green;
border-left-color : green;
width : 168px;
padding-top : 5px;
padding-bottom : 5px;
margin-top : 10px;
margin-bottom : 10px;
color : green;
border-top-width : 1px;
border-right-width : 1px;
border-top-style : dotted;
border-right-style : dotted;
border-top-color : green;
border-right-color : green;
}

.limenu{
	font-size : 13px;
line-height : 130%;
text-align : left;
list-style-type : disc;
list-style-position : outside;
margin-left : 15px;
list-style-image : url(images/list.gif);
margin-top : 5px;
margin-bottom : 5px;
padding-left : 5px;
}


.text2r{
	color : red;
font-weight : bold;
}
.favorite{
	margin-bottom : 10px;
margin-top : 5px;
}
.text1{
	font-size : 10px;
}
.cover4{
	font-size : 12px;
background-image : url(images/d017bcg.gif);
padding-top : 10px;
padding-left : 10px;
padding-right : 10px;
padding-bottom : 10px;border-width : 1px 1px 1px 1px;border-style : dotted dotted dotted dotted;border-color : green green green green;
width : 650px;

margin-bottom : 10px;




margin-left : auto;
margin-right : auto;



margin-top : 5px;
}
p{
	line-height : 120%;
margin-top : 3px;
margin-left : 0px;
margin-right : 0px;
margin-bottom : 3px;
}

.clear {
	clear: both;
}
.yweb{
	padding-left : 15px;
padding-bottom : 15px;
}

.textq{
	font-size : 20px;
font-weight : bold;
}


